How do you use water in Cinema 4D?

To make water in Cinema 4D, you have to follow these simple steps: Step 1: Create a plane and drop a displacer underneath the plane. Step 2: Add noise to the displacer’s shader, create a subdivision surface and drop everything underneath it. Step 3: Change the Animation Speed to 1-2%.25 mai 2021

How do you make water look real on a project?

Paint the underwater area of your project with acrylic paints in the color you want the water to be. To make the water look as though it gets deeper, such as at a beach scene, paint the darkest shade farthest from the shore or beach, adding successively more white to the paint as you get closer to the shoreline.

What is turbulence FD?

Turbulence FD is a powerful simulation tool to create smoke, fire and explosion effects developed by Jawset Visual Computing. C4DtoA ships with native Turbulence FD support.

What can you use for fake water?

Way #1: Candle gel wax. You can make fake water in a terrarium by using candle gel wax like this. Candle gel wax is mainly made mineral oil, and some resin added to the mix. To make artificial water with candle gel, take a small piece of candle gel wax, put it in a small pot, and melt until it’s liquid.
